Output 0756e1fa0fedb62ae85da1ac03119d4630cec8b3554787b6d1bfe047aa79d1d9:70

value
44579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5931c12a8396ef9c050deabeecfa35c5cbf47d OP_EQUAL
address
32ubZNQaDYL6JKs5RXnHMcxmHjSoqEwEM6
transaction
0756e1fa0fedb62ae85da1ac03119d4630cec8b3554787b6d1bfe047aa79d1d9
spent
true